GS#498 September 21, 2015 : This week we play alongside Web.com Touring Pro Adam Long at TPC Stonebrae the day before the start of the Web.com Stonebrae Classic in the SF Bay Area. During this Pro-Am round the Duke University graduate, Adam Long of New Orleans, talks about his career, his prospects of making it to the PGA Tour, and the strengths of his game. This is just a portion of the complete interview with Adam. The full interview is a video which includes selected conversations with his caddie Derek about club and shot selection, how to attack various holes and pin positions, reading greens, strategy conversations with Chas Narramore, another player on the Tour, our threesome and more. improvement conversations like this that are no longer available in any podcast app. I don't know what the winning shares exactly this year, but I think the purse is somewhere around 600,000 this week that we're playing for. So the top 65 in ties. But that's 600,000 is split among... Split between the top 65. That make the cut. But like the winning share, I'm not sure it changes every week, but it's usually close to $100,000. Last week was actually in Boise. It was $144,000 last week. And this week, I don't think the purse is quite as big, but it's 110 or something like that to the winner. But to give you the range, if you make the cut, which is great, but if you make the cut and finish last, you probably make about $1,300. So it's everywhere in between. If you finish fifth, you might make $20,000, something like that, $30,000 maybe. And everywhere in between, you know, top 25 would be somewhere around the 4,000 range, 5,000 range. So, you know, you're making money as you go and paying off your expenses. It's a big difference from the top to the...
